3. Master NEET Physics Chapter-Wise
Not all chapters are equal in NEET. Understanding weightage and scoring potential is essential. At Smart Achievers, we guide students chapter by chapter for maximum efficiency.
High-Weightage Chapters:
Mechanics (Kinematics, Laws of Motion, Work-Energy-Power) – 25–30 marks
Electrostatics & Current Electricity – 15–20 marks
Optics – 10–15 marks
Modern Physics – 10–12 marks
Thermodynamics & Oscillations – 8–10 marks
Medium/Low-Weightage Chapters:
Magnetism
Gravitation
Fluid Mechanics
Properties of Matter
Strategy: Prioritize high-weightage chapters, but don’t ignore smaller ones—they can provide easy marks.
4. Practice Previous Years’ Papers & Mock Tests
Success in NEET Physics is 90% practice, 10% theory. Smart Achievers emphasizes:
Previous 10–15 years’ NEET papers to analyze patterns.
Chapter-wise problem solving to strengthen weak areas.
Regular full-length mock tests that simulate the actual exam environment.
Benefits of Mock Tests:
Improves speed and accuracy under time pressure.
Helps identify strong and weak areas.
Builds exam temperament and confidence.
Tip: After every mock test, make a detailed analysis sheet. Note mistakes, revise concepts, and practice similar problems.
5. Focus on Formulae, Units, and Short Tricks
Physics questions often require quick application of formulas. At Smart Achievers, we make students formula-smart:
Maintain a formula notebook for each chapter.
Learn units, dimensions, and standard constants.
Practice shortcuts and numerical tricks for quick calculations.
Example:
Using v2=u2+2as as directly to solve motion problems instead of going step by step.
Using dimensional analysis to eliminate incorrect options instantly.
Tip: A well-prepared formula sheet can save precious minutes in the exam.
6. Smart Attempt Strategy
NEET Physics is not about solving all questions, it’s about solving smartly.
Our Strategy at Smart Achievers:
Start with easy and high-confidence questions.
Attempt numerical problems you’ve practiced repeatedly.
Avoid getting stuck on lengthy or tricky questions—time is limited.
Tip: Aim to attempt 40–45 questions correctly with accuracy, rather than attempting all 50 and risking negative marks.

8. Common Mistakes to Avoid
Many students lose marks due to preventable mistakes. Smart Achievers focuses on avoiding pitfalls:
Skipping theory: Physics needs concepts, not just formulas.
Neglecting weaker chapters: Even small chapters can provide easy marks.
Ignoring units and significant figures in numerical problems.
Blind guessing: Attempt only when reasonably confident.
Last-minute cramming: Leads to confusion and stress.
Tip: Smart preparation + consistent practice = no last-minute panic.
